Locusts Cover Cactus, Sardinia
A Swarm of Locusts move over cactus growing in a field in Sardinia during a locust plague on the island.
ca. 1945
Gelatin silver print
Image: 18.1 x 22.9 cm
Gift of Donald K. Weber, 2009
2008.0025.0001
Inscriptions Recto: (typed attached label): 13196-D/ ASSOCIATED PRESS PHOTO FROM NEW YORK/CAUTION: USE CREDIT/ (EDS:THIS IS ONE OF A SET OF PICTURES)/ LOCUSTS COVER CACTUS/ A SWARM OF LOCUSTS MOVE OVER/ CACTUS GROWING IN A FIELD IN SARDINIA DURING/ A LOCUST PLAGUE ON THE ISLAND. VOLUNTEERS,/ EQUIPPED WITH FLAME AND GAS THROWERS, MOVED/ THROUGH INFESTED AREAS, BURNING AND GASSING/THE LOCUSTS BEFORE THEY WERE ABLE TO FLY./ ASSOCIATED PRESS PHOTO/ PJM- 5/26/46- 1130A- ROME 141/ WAB-NY MAT S-TIME INC-PA-MEX CITY
